在数据中心发布操作期间启用impex日志记录

2020-08-31 10:34发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


你好

任何人都可以帮助我如何启用日志记录功能来记录在数据中心发布期间创建的实际impex吗?

hybris服务器上的日志显示已处理的记录数,但未看到实际的Impex。

例如-这是当数据中心将数据发布到Hybris服务器时看到的内容。 INFO [TaskExecutor-master-1272-Task [8796126184374]](000001JV)[导入器]在0d 00 h:00m:00s:008ms中完成1遍-已处理:3,没有任何行转储(最后一遍0)

是否有任何方法可以记录整个impex以查看其确切插入的内容? 我想看到像INSERT_UPDATE FutureStock ;; quantity; date [dateformat = yyyyMMdd]; productCode(code)10; 100; 20180315; 100000143; 25; 200; 20180501; 100000143

预先感谢。

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


你好

任何人都可以帮助我如何启用日志记录功能来记录在数据中心发布期间创建的实际impex吗?

hybris服务器上的日志显示已处理的记录数,但未看到实际的Impex。

例如-这是当数据中心将数据发布到Hybris服务器时看到的内容。 INFO [TaskExecutor-master-1272-Task [8796126184374]](000001JV)[导入器]在0d 00 h:00m:00s:008ms中完成1遍-已处理:3,没有任何行转储(最后一遍0)

是否有任何方法可以记录整个impex以查看其确切插入的内容? 我想看到像INSERT_UPDATE FutureStock ;; quantity; date [dateformat = yyyyMMdd]; productCode(code)10; 100; 20180315; 100000143; 25; 200; 20180501; 100000143

预先感谢。

付费偷看设置
发送
7条回答
南山jay
1楼-- · 2020-08-31 11:21

Data Hub出版物将在Hybris端创建Impex CronJobs。 如果失败,您可以查看那里的导入媒体。

ZJXianG
2楼-- · 2020-08-31 11:14

如果成功导入,则cronjob会删除媒体

我是小鹏鹏啊
3楼-- · 2020-08-31 11:15

嗨,Sasi,

请在SAP Hybris产品支持部门中创建事件,我们将向您发送将记录ImpEx的文档和扩展名。

本质上,魔术在于扩展 CoreAdapterService 并使用 impexService.generateImpexBlocks() ImpexWriterUtils.buildImpexFileContent() 覆盖 publish()方法。

致谢,
卢克

Haoba3210
4楼-- · 2020-08-31 11:30

不客气,Sasi,

您能否接受我的回答,以便其他人将来知道如何处理此请求?

致谢,
卢克

Climb_Ma
5楼-- · 2020-08-31 11:13

在Hybris方面:ImportService.importData()带有一个带有RemoveOnSuccess字段的ImportConfig项。 如果将导入cronjob设置为true并成功完成,导入服务将删除它。 因此,在Datahub导入的情况下,需要自定义以保留已处理的cronjobs媒体。

N-Moskvin
6楼-- · 2020-08-31 11:10

谢谢!

一周热门 更多>